Abstract :
[en] In this application paper we’ll explain the work flow we use
to create immersive visualizations and spatial interaction for
geophysical data with a head mounted device (HMD). The
data that we analyze consists of two dimensional geographical
map data and raw geophysical measurements with devices
like seismometers, Electrical Resistivity Tomography (ERT)
and seismic tomography profiles as well as other geophysical
and geoscientific data. We show the tool chain that we use
while explaining the choices that we made along the way. The
technical description will be followed by a brief assessment of
the added benefit of rendering our data in virtual reality (VR).
After the technical description we conclude this paper with
some outlook on the (likely) future use of VR in geosciences.
